Short prior authorization delays for drug therapy did not cause vision loss in most patients newly diagnosed with age-related macular degeneration (AMD). However, a small number of people — especially those with subretinal hemorrhage — experienced loss of visual acuity while waiting and failed to recover after 6 months.
The research, presented at the American Society of Retina Specialists (ASRS) 2026 Annual Meeting in Montreal, found the average wait for prior authorization between diagnosis and first treatment was 12.2 days. Nearly 5% of eyes showed long-term vision decline past 6 months.
“Prior authorization treatment delays were not associated with short-term vision changes in neovascular AMD,” said J. Mingyi Huang, MD, retina specialist and vitreoretinal surgeon at The Retina Group of Washington in Fredericksburg, Virginia.
The retrospective cohort study included 249 eyes from 225 patients who were diagnosed with neovascular AMD and scheduled for a first intravitreal injection between November 2024 and October 2025 at The Retina Group of Washington. Patients who had previous treatments or missed an appointment were excluded. Patients with diabetic macular edema or retinal vein occlusion were also excluded.
Huang and colleagues found mean visual acuity for the total cohort did not change significantly from baseline to the first treatment visit, from 20/84 to 20/88.
However, 12 eyes in the cohort lost three or more lines of vision during their waiting period for prior authorization. Their cumulative vision worsened from 20/152 at diagnosis to 20/575 at their first injection visit. Six months later, the average vision was 20/168 in these participants compared with 20/77 in those who had not experienced loss during the wait (P = .039). The average waiting time between groups was not significantly different.
Overall, 6 of the 12 eyes had an initial subretinal hemorrhage at intake and one had a large pigment epithelial detachment, but none had any significant changes in pathology between the initial diagnosis and injection visit, Huang said.
Stop Gaps
The study is meaningful, if small, because waiting for prior authorization for intravitreal drugs is universal among retina practices, said Manju Subramanian, MD, associate professor at Boston University Chobanian & Avedisian School of Medicine in Boston, who moderated the study panel.
Subramanian took an impromptu poll of the audience, finding about 20% indicated they give samples of drugs while patients await prior authorization. She treats patients initially with bevacizumab while awaiting prior authorization.
“The risk you run with delaying care is that patients can get worsening retinal bleeding during that time while you’re waiting for prior authorization,” she said. “There are a lot of clinicians out there who have to wait on prior authorizations, and maybe they don’t have access to samples from companies,” including her own, she said.
Huang said if a patient has a subretinal image at the initial visit, “I will try to fight more to get same-day authorization.”
The use of bevacizumab as a stopgap can vary among retina specialists because the drug needs to be formulated for ophthalmic use by compounding pharmacies.
“If you’re in a practice setting that doesn’t have access to a good compounding pharmacy, then you’re probably not going to use it as much,” Subramanian said. “It’s a great drug for how much it costs.”
